Transaction f66434453fc18951de872d043715a8babb98291cc3e3cad0fd1ed530b6f2d42f
1 Input
1 Output
-
f66434453fc18951de872d043715a8babb98291cc3e3cad0fd1ed530b6f2d42f:0
- value
- 29114474
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27dd833c2d96d5381c5b5b9001573ad0e40b9b3d OP_EQUAL
- address
- 35KodzYe3KeaFqQyCkSgZkfncq8MSg7f3c